
Katie George contributed to the cloudscape-design repositories by building and refining reusable React components focused on file handling, prompt input, and multiselect UI patterns. She introduced internal file upload modules and enhanced the ButtonGroup to support in-context file selection, improving code organization and user experience. Her work included implementing internationalization with I18nProvider, updating notification theming for accessibility, and integrating inline token displays for compact multiselects. Using TypeScript, SCSS, and JavaScript, Katie addressed bugs such as date formatting and prop propagation, while ensuring robust test coverage and documentation. Her engineering demonstrated depth in component architecture, accessibility, and design system consistency.

January 2025 monthly summary: Delivered two substantive UI features across cloudscape-design repositories with a strong emphasis on accessibility, UX density, and design-system consistency. Implemented Inline Tokens Display for Multiselect in cloudscape-design/components, enabling a compact display of selected options, with a new ARIA label generation constant and updated component props to support inline tokens. Introduced SupportPromptGroup in cloudscape-design/chat-components, offering predefined prompts, vertical/horizontal alignment options, robust keyboard navigation, accessibility features, and accompanying tests and documentation. No major bugs reported this month; focus remained on feature completeness, test coverage, and developer experience. Technologies demonstrated include React component design, accessibility (ARIA), test-driven development, and comprehensive documentation across repositories.

November 2024 highlights for cloudscape-design/components: Delivered a cohesive File Handling UI overhaul with a new FileInput, FileDropzone, and FileTokenGroup, including refactoring FileUpload usage, new page containers, and UI refinements (notably disabling animations on the permutations page to improve stability). Implemented internationalization support by introducing an I18nProvider for the file upload and file token group components. Updated notification severity theming with expanded color tokens across critical, high, medium, low, and neutral to ensure clearer and more accessible UI indicators. Fixed a date display bug for the file token group last modified date to ensure accurate display. Overall, these changes improve file management UX, enable localization, and deliver consistent theming, contributing to faster feature adoption and reduced support friction. Key engineering competencies demonstrated include componentization and reusability, design token-based theming, internationalization, accessibility considerations, and performance-minded UI tweaks.
